aboutsummaryrefslogtreecommitdiff
path: root/example
diff options
context:
space:
mode:
Diffstat (limited to 'example')
-rw-r--r--example/64x64.pngbin0 -> 206 bytes
-rw-r--r--example/example.html17
-rw-r--r--example/example.js38
3 files changed, 55 insertions, 0 deletions
diff --git a/example/64x64.png b/example/64x64.png
new file mode 100644
index 0000000..d889069
--- /dev/null
+++ b/example/64x64.png
Binary files differ
diff --git a/example/example.html b/example/example.html
new file mode 100644
index 0000000..889c1c8
--- /dev/null
+++ b/example/example.html
@@ -0,0 +1,17 @@
+<!DOCTYPE html>
+<html lang="en">
+<head>
+ <meta charset="UTF-8">
+ <meta name="viewport" content="width=device-width, initial-scale=1.0">
+ <meta http-equiv="X-UA-Compatible" content="ie=edge">
+ <title>Vanilla Yo Notification</title>
+</head>
+<body>
+ <button onclick="showNotificationSuccess()">Show Success Notification</button>
+ <button onclick="showNotificationWarning()">Show Warning Notification</button>
+ <button onclick="showNotificationError()">Show Error Notification</button>
+
+ <script src="../dist/vanilla-yo-notification.js"></script>
+ <script src="./example.js"></script>
+</body>
+</html> \ No newline at end of file
diff --git a/example/example.js b/example/example.js
new file mode 100644
index 0000000..4500c70
--- /dev/null
+++ b/example/example.js
@@ -0,0 +1,38 @@
+(function(window){
+ var notif = new VanillaYoNotification({
+ position: ['bottom', 'left']
+ });
+ var counter = 0;
+ window.showNotificationSuccess = function(){
+
+ notif.show({
+ title: 'Notification Title',
+ content: `This is a content ${counter}`,
+ timeout: 6000
+ });
+
+ counter += 1;
+ }
+ window.showNotificationWarning = function(){
+
+ notif.show({
+ title: 'Notification Title',
+ content: '<b>This is a content</b>',
+ type: 'warning',
+ timeout: 1000
+ });
+ }
+ window.showNotificationError = function(){
+
+ notif.show({
+ title: 'Notification Title',
+ content: 'This is a content with image <img src="64x64.png"/>',
+ type: 'error',
+ timeout: 2000
+ });
+ }
+
+
+
+
+})(window); \ No newline at end of file